开发常识 持续更新~~
生活随笔
收集整理的這篇文章主要介紹了
开发常识 持续更新~~
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
目錄: 1.基本元素分類常識
一、元素分類:行內元素,行內塊元素、塊級元素
1.行內元素(內聯元素):span,a,b,i,u,textarea,input,select,img,
特征:
- (1)寬高weight,height值無效;
- (2)對margin僅左右有效,上下無效;padding上下左右都有效;但是上下只是撐大了空間,并沒有邊距效果;
- (3)不會自動進行換行;
- (4)寬高是由本身內容的大小決定(文字、圖片等);
- (5)只能容納文本或者其他行內元素(此處請注意,不要在內聯元素中嵌套塊級元素)
2.塊狀元素:div,h1~h6,ol-li,ul-li,dl,dd,dt,table,p,form,hr等等
特征:
- (1)隨意設置寬高;
- (2)margin和padding的上下左右均對其有效;
- (3)會自動換行;
- (4)多個塊狀元素標簽寫在一起,默認排列方式為從上至下
- (5)在不設置寬度的情況下,塊級元素的寬度是它父級元素內容的寬度;
- (6)在不設置高度的情況下,塊級元素的高度是它本身內容的高度;
3.行內塊狀元素
(1)display:inline;轉換為行內元素 (2)display:block;轉換為塊狀元素 (3)display:inline-block;轉換為行內塊狀元素 復制代碼特征:
- (1)不自動換行;
- (2)能夠識別寬高;
- (3)默認排列方式為從左到右;
總結
以上是生活随笔為你收集整理的开发常识 持续更新~~的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: socket.io 之 engine.i
- 下一篇: python将图片转化为字符图